What happened
The accident occurred during a night instrument training flight conducted in mountainous terrain. The aircraft was being flown by a certified flight instructor (CFI) who had a student pilot under instruction. At the time of the incident, the student pilot was wearing a view-limiting device, commonly referred to as a hood, which restricted their external visual references and required them to rely entirely on instrument scanning.
During this phase of the flight, the CFI directed the aircraft to maintain a specific altitude and heading that led directly toward a ridgeline. While issuing these navigation instructions, the instructor attended to a technical issue with the portable intercom system used for communication between the front and rear seats. Specifically, the CFI changed the battery in the device while the student was actively flying the aircraft toward the rising terrain.
The aircraft subsequently impacted the rising mountain terrain along the heading and altitude assigned by the CFI. The impact occurred because the flight path intersected with the ground profile in the area of the ridgeline, resulting in a controlled flight into terrain (CFIT) event.
The investigation
Examination of the accident site and aircraft components revealed that the aircraft struck rising mountain terrain. The flight path was consistent with the heading and altitude parameters established by the flight instructor immediately prior to impact. No mechanical failures or malfunctions were identified that would have precluded normal operation of the aircraft's systems.
Findings
The primary factor contributing to this accident was the flight instructor's decision to direct the aircraft toward rising terrain while simultaneously diverting attention from monitoring the student pilot's adherence to safe flight parameters. The instructor failed to ensure that the assigned heading and altitude did not conflict with the known mountainous topography of the area.
Additionally, the use of a view-limiting device during night instrument flight in mountainous terrain required heightened situational awareness and terrain avoidance planning by the instructor. The combination of limited visibility due to the hood, night conditions, and the instructor's distraction with the intercom battery change created a critical lapse in terrain monitoring.
Safety message
Flight instructors must maintain continuous monitoring of the student pilot's flight path, especially when operating in mountainous terrain or during night instrument conditions. Diverting attention from flight monitoring to attend to equipment issues while directing the aircraft toward known hazards can lead to catastrophic outcomes. Terrain avoidance must remain the priority during all phases of training flights in restricted visibility environments.
